View Article  PRODUCT PREVIEW - POWERFUL NEW DRIVERS IN THE MAKING
Benross V6 driver
Benross V6 driver for 2007

Two new drivers will emerge from the stable in 2007 as the flagship clubs .The V6 TriMass VMC and V5 460 drivers aim to reinforce the growing attraction to the re-designed Benross brand, which launched a new corporate identity at the golf-Europe trade show in Munich at the weekend.

Benross also launched fairway and rescue clubs to compliment the new drivers, as well as three sets of irons, wedges and putters.

The V6 TriMass VMC driver (£149), will be available in three lofts (9, 10.5 and 14 degree) but only in a right-handed version. It features three moveable weights (with free wrench) to deliver a neutral, draw or fade bias. An Aldila NV65 shaft (regular or stiff flex) is fitted as standard to compliment the lime green flashes on the clubhead

The £99 V5 460 is more suited to the mid to high handicap golfer, with its high launch, low spin ball flight and large sweet spot. It also has a distinctive orange Aldila NVS65 shaft and burnt orange Golf Pride grip (pink for the women's version). Available in four lofts and well as senior and women's flex shafts. Left-hand only in 10.5 and 14 degree lofts.

V6 TriMass VMC fairway metals are available in 3-, 4- and 5-wood versions (£99) and similar lime green shafts, while V5 fairway metals cost £79.99 and are available in 3-, 4, 5- and 7-wood models with a range of orange shafts and orange or pink grips for right and left-handers.

The V6 TriMass and V5 brands extend into Escape utility woods for 2007 to replace the Escape 3G models and will have a recommended price of £89.99 and £69.99 respectively. The women's version of the V5 Escape will cost £49.99 with a lightweight Aldila TM70 shaft and pink grip.

View Article  ALL NEW RAINWEAR AVAILABLE NOW !!

Benross waterproof range
Benross Extreme jacket

Already firmly established with its range of clubs and bags, plans to introduce waterproof rainwear in the Autumn.

There'll be four jacket models - Extreme, Executive (full length zip), Summit and Sport, all with colour co-ordinated trousers available. Features include stretch fabrics and second skin linings for enhanced breathability.

There's also a choice of striking colours, including black electric and red and fashionable design styles, with zip-off sleeves and great attention to detail.

Each waterproof item has a three-year waterproof guarantee.

The range include Summit half- zip and Extreme full-zip jackets (£79.99), Sport half-zip top (£59.99) and Executive full zip top (£59.99). All have zip-off sleeves.

View Article  PRODUCT PREVIEW

Benross VX50  forged irons
Benross VX50 forged iron

Buoyed by its success in 2006, we aim to break new ground with three new models of Benross iron, including the VX50 Forged - its first foray into the 'clubs for better players' market.

The advanced, cavity-back design of the VX50 Forged features different combinations of steel in the heads of the 3- to 6-iron, compared to the 7-iron to pitching wedge, in an effort to bring a softer feel to the scoring clubs.

With True Temper Dynamic Gold shafts and Golf Pride Tour Velvet grips, you'll pay £349 for eight irons (3- PW) with options of S300 or r300 shaft flexes.

The new VX5 irons incorporate the TriMass weight-positioning system and a deep centre of gravity to make long and mid irons easier to hit. The clubs are available in True Temper Dynamic Lite steel or Aldila TM70 graphite shaft options (4-SW). Recommended price is £249 (steel) or £299 (graphite).

Benross VXCombo OS iron
Benross VX Combo OS iron
Benross claims the updated VX OverSize (OS) Combo irons used in conjunction with new V5 Escape hybrid utility clubs take combination sets to a new level in launch angle and forgiveness.

A standard 3-SW set will cost £299, while a 5-SW set, including the introduction 3- and 4- V5 Escape hybrids, are priced the same. Other recommended combinations are 3-SW graphite (£329), 4-SW graphite (£229), 5-SW steel 9£199) and 5-SW graphite (£249).

Benross putters have proved very popular in the last 12 months and 2007 will see the introduction of the Ripple VMC SV2 with four adjustable weights either centre or heel shafted (£69.99) and the SRII with dual fixed tungsten weight ports and an oval milled aluminium face insert (£49.99).

Benross Ripple SR VMC SV2 putter
Benross Ripple SR VMC SV2 putter
Two wedges complete the 2007 Benross hardwear - the VX Forged series and the Sweet Feel (SF) 20 series. The VX forged (£49.99) has lofts of 52,56 and 60 degrees (right hand only), while the Sweet Feel features a classic teardrop head shape black nickel finish (£39.99) in five lofts from 48 to 60 degrees.

Benross completes its range with three new bags in a choice of 12 colours including orange, green, blue and pink. Models are Z7 cart bag (£79.99), M7 Lite stand bag (£59.99) and B7 Lite stand bag (£39.99).
